How much do 3d graphics designer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for 3d graphics designer in Michigan is $32.11,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.33 and $37.07 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a 3D graphics designer?

A 3D Graphics Designer is a creative professional who uses specialized software to create three-dimensional models, animations, and visual effects for various media, such as video games, movies, advertisements, and product visualizations. Their work involves developing detailed textures, lighting, and rendering to bring digital scenes and objects to life. 3D Graphics Designers often collaborate with other artists, engineers, or clients to achieve the desired look and functionality for a project. They need both artistic and technical skills to turn concepts into visually engaging digital content.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a 3D graphics designer?

To thrive as a 3D Graphics Designer, you need expertise in 3D modeling, texturing, lighting, and rendering, usually backed by a degree in graphic design, visual arts, or a related field. Proficiency in industry-standard software such as Autodesk Maya, Blender, 3ds Max, and Adobe Creative Suite is typically required. Strong creativity,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help designers collaborate and bring complex concepts to life. These abilities ensure high-quality visual output, efficient project execution, and strong alignment with client or project objectives.

What are some common challenges 3D graphics designers face when working on collaborative projects?

3D Graphics Designers often work closely with teams including animators, developers, and project managers, which can present challenges in aligning creative visions and technical requirements. Communication is key, as misinterpretations can lead to design revisions or project delays. Additionally, balancing artistic creativity with client or project specifications, and managing feedback from multiple stakeholders, requires strong organizational and interpersonal skills. Staying updated on evolving software and industry standards is also essential for seamless collaboration.

How much does a 3D graphics designer make?

A 3D graphics designer's salary varies based on experience, location, and industry, but typically ranges from $50,000 to $85,000 annually in the United States. Senior designers with advanced skills in software like Blender, Maya, or 3ds Max can earn higher salaries, especially in specialized fields such as gaming, film, or virtual reality.

Is 3D Graphics Designer a good career?

A 3D Graphics Designer is a viable career choice for those with strong artistic skills and proficiency in software like Blender or Maya. The field offers opportunities in industries such as gaming, film, and advertising, with job prospects improving as demand for visual content grows. Success often requires continuous learning and portfolio development.

The Purpose

Czarnowski is seeking a talented and energetic 3D environmental designer to join our Detroit Studio, working with our General Motors clients. We are an in‑person, collaborative group that feeds off each other’s creative thought and personality, striving to create unique answers to our client’s marketing objectives. Successful candidates will possess strong conceptual and executional 3D design skills for environmental and experiential marketing programs. This candidate should have dynamic, persuasive presentation ability, exceptional visual communications and problem‑solving talent. The ideal candidate will have experience in exhibit or experiential design and understand general engineering, production and execution methodology. Must be able to design quickly to set goals, meet objectives and communicate big ideas with passion.

The Job Responsibilities
  • Design dynamic solutions that clearly communicate brand goals, and strategy.
  • Ensure presentations deliver the objectives of the project brief and clearly articulate design solutions to both internal and external teams.
  • Rapidly generate ideation, direction sketches, research and reference images, design model and visualize exhibit / experiential space(s) for multiple shows.
  • Strong ability to translate a brand into an emotional multi‑dimensional experience.
  • Work with graphic designers on environmental graphic applications and provide direction on production expectations.
  • Help facilitate feedback and project direction to all cross‑functional team members.
  • Communicate clear layouts for print production, art files, estimating and production documentation.
  • Manage the handoff and control doc process from Design to Estimating and Engineering, through the production process and on‑site execution.
  • Present and check in with the Executive / Senior Creative Director, as well as the Account team throughout the duration of the project.
  • Inspire the team through energy and optimism, pushing the envelope to advance the program and its goals.
  • Engage and collaborate in‑person and virtually with the overall creative studio and the cross‑functional team members.
  • Some traveling may be required as well as extended hours at night, weekends and during holidays.
The Person (Qualifications)
  • BFA in industrial design, exhibit design, interior design, architectural or equivalent creative field.
  • 2-3 years of industry experience or related.
  • Good understanding of engineering, production techniques / processes, materials & finishes.
  • Strong design aesthetics and ability to constantly adapt to meet a breadth of varied brand styles and mediums.
  • Ability to understand a brand at its core and then translate it into other 3D environments and other experiential mediums.
  • Exceptional interpersonal communication skills across all mediums and an ability to pitch ideas to internal and external stakeholders with conviction.
  • High performance/high productivity mentality that can independently execute against creative needs.
  • Ability to brainstorm with a large group of various team members & clients.
  • Experience working with large format graphics & 3‑dimensional environments.
  • Must work in Rhino and VRay for all 3D modeling (or show aptitude to quickly learn) and be proficient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ign and other Adobe Suite of products.
  • Knowledgeable in AI prompting for idea generation and visualization.
  • Exceptional organizational and time management skills – ability to balance multiple projects at one time while ensuring quality and consistency.
